BN vs PNC: by the numbers

  • BN is the larger company ($100.98B vs $95.44B market cap).
  • PNC trades at the lower earnings multiple (13.81 vs 87.53 P/E).
  • PNC converts more revenue to profit (22.51% vs 1.74% net margin).
  • PNC grew revenue faster over the past five years (12.91% vs 4.12% CAGR).
  • PNC pays the higher dividend yield (2.86% vs 0.42%).
